Australia To Chair International Renewable Energy Agency, By Ross Kelly Jul 13, 2011, NASDAQ , SYDNEY -(Dow Jones) Australia has been elected as the inaugural chair of the International Renewable Energy Agency, established to promote the increased adoption of green energy worldwide, Energy and Resources Minister Martin Ferguson saidThursday.

Established in 2009, IRENA held its inaugural assembly in Abu Dhabi in April this year. It has 77 members, while 149 states and the European Union have ratified its statute.

“International cooperation is vital in accelerating the deployment of new technologies by driving down costs,” Ferguson said in a statement.  “Australia’s election to this leadership role reflects our commitment to developing renewable energy.”

Australia on Sunday released details of a plan to impose a tax on carbon emissions of A$23 per metric ton from July 1, 2012. It also announced A$13.2 billion in government support for renewable energy projects.
